Highlights
Are people in Mission older or younger than people in Fairbury?
- The Median Age in Mission is 17.5 years younger than in Fairbury.
Are housing costs cheaper in Mission or Fairbury?
- Mission
housing
costs are 26.0% less expensive than Fairbury hous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Mission or Fairbury?
- The average commute for residents of Mission is 0.1 minutes longer than it is for residents of Fairbury.

Things to do in Mission?
Living in Mission, SD is a unique experience. The town is situated within the Rosebud Indian Reservation and has a population of only around 200 people. It's a quiet, rural community with friendly locals who will welcome you with open arms. The town offers breathtaking views of the plains and surrounding area, making it a wonderful place to relax and unwind after a long day. There are plenty of outdoor activities to do in the area including hiking, fishing, and bird watching for nature enthusiasts. Mission also has several restaurants and stores to shop at for all your needs. Overall, living in Mission is an enjoyable experience that can be full of surprises!
